Maria Sharapova, Andy Murray to play for Manila IPTL Franchise

Russian tennis superstar Maria Sharapova and Great Britain’s Andy Murray will become part of Team Manila for the upcoming International Premier Tennis League (IPTL) which will have its inaugural event in November. Joining Sharapova and Murray for the Philippine team is the country’s number one player Treat Huey, Frenchman Jo-Wilfried Tsonga, Belgian Kirsten Flipkens, Canada’s Daniel Nestor and Spaniard Carlos Moya.

The Manila leg of the IPTL will take place from November 28 to 30 at the Araneta Coliseum.

“We are happy that our Philippines No. 1 and current ATP Doubles Top 30 Treat Huey has joined the Manila team, so his fans finally get to see him live in action at a home event for the first time,” Philippine Tennis Association president Edwin L. Olivarez said in a statement.

Manila will be the first IPTL stop followed by the cities in Singapore, India and United Arab Emirates. The Philippine team will be named Manila Mavericks and will compete with UAE Royals, Indian Aces and Singapore Slammers. The winning team will win $1 million.

The UAE Royals will be comprised of Novak Djokovic, Richard Gasquet, Janko Tipsarevic, Goran Ivanisevic, Caroline Wozniacki, Martina Hingis, Nenad Zimonjic and top UAE player Malek Jaziri.

The IPTL is a newly conceived tennis competition that will feature the best ATP and WTA players, former and current, which will compete in four cities in Asia. The competition proper will start on November 28 and conclude on December 13.

Each team will play a total of 24 matches in a round-robin format that was set up for this event.
